The demand for qualified candidates in the finance sector is at an all-time high, with many companies struggling to recruit the right finance candidates. While this poses a challenge to employers, it’s an advantage for professionals looking to progress their careers and increase their earning potential. An MBA in finance provides students with a comprehensive background in financial management, accounting, and quantitative analysis. With a finance degree, you will be equipped with the analytical skills and communication skills necessary for success in the finance industry. Those interested in finance can enter the field as trainees, debt research analysts, or managers of corporate finance. After obtaining your MBA, you can also pursue research or higher studies to advance your knowledge. A career in finance requires advanced knowledge of a variety of different aspects of business, and those with an MBA in finance can apply their knowledge to an array of industries and gain valuable experience through a wide range of positions. The salary potential of an MBA in this field is highly dependent upon location and experience. Generally, a finance manager can earn between Rs. 3-4 lacs. The salary of a financial manager can increase considerably with experience. An MBA in finance can lead to a career in investment banking. Investment bankers are often economists with a background in finance and may have an MBA in finance. An MBA in finance can lead to a lucrative career in this sector. While fresher investment bankers typically earn commission-based salaries, experienced professionals work as consultants and can earn up to one crore in salary. This makes it one of the highest-paying jobs in India.
